No. 10 CSU tennis sweeps Morehouse 9-0 at home
The No. 10-ranked Columbus State tennis team cruised to a 9-0 victory over Morehouse on Monday in a non-conference match at the Mary V. Blackmon Tennis Center. With the win, the Cougars are now 10-3 on the season.
Columbus State won all three doubles matches, with the duos of KP Pannu and Zach Whaanga defeating Jabez Beazer and Justin Samples 8-4, Marco Almorin and Jorge Vargas sweeping Brandon Sanders and PJ Stamps 8-0, and Benedikt Wilde and Martynas Zakaitis sweeping Rasheed Slade and Ziha Meghoo-Peddie 8-0.
In singles action, the Cougars lost just six games in six matches. Pannu won 6-0, 6-2, Almorin 6-1, 6-1, Vargas 6-0, 6-0, Whaanga 6-0, 6-0, Zakaitis 6-1, 6-0 and Wilde 6-1, 6-0.
Columbus State plays a key Peach Belt Conference match against Armstrong State on Saturday at 11 a.m. at home.
